Side shifter: A type of attachment that enables a driver to position the attachment arm laterally for more effective load placement is called a side shifter.
Forklift fork Positioner: The positioner is a hydraulic attachment which helps position the forks either simultaneously or separately, according to the load size. It relieves lift trucks operators from having to manually adjust the forks.
Pole Attachments: A type of attachment which are utilized to lift carpet rolls are known as a pole attachment.
Telescopic forklift forks: These attachments allow the driver to load and unload vehicles from a single side. They permit the handling of two differently-sized pallets simultaneously and are really handy for double-deep racking.
Forklift carton clamp attachments: Through the application of uniform clamping force, these hydraulic attachments make handling high-volume carton easier. They are equipped with arm pads lined with four-way reversible rubber. A backrest to the loads helps prevent damage to the loads.
Slip sheet attachment: An option to the pallet systems is the slip sheet attachment. Thisstoring system and hydraulic transport clamps onto the slip sheet to be able to draw it onto a thin and wide metal fork. Useful for intra-corporate deliveries and for shipping abroad.
Man Basket: A platform which can slide onto forklift forks is known as a man basket. It is designed to raise workers. Safety features comprise railings to be able to avoid falls and brackets used for attaching safety harnesses.
